  • I'd recommend steering clear of Humm. If you miss a payment (mistakes happen!), they don't notify you. They simply take the $10 fee, even if you have more than one card loaded. They'll keep charging fees until the payment goes through. Again, no notification at all. No emails to say you've missed a payment or to say the fee has been charged.

    I'm usually very good with paying my bills on time, but I logged into my Humm account the other day to find six $10 fees charged back in March when my credit card expired without me realising. Again, absolutely no communication from Humm - they just take the money. I didn't even realise I was missing payments, as I would have expected a "You've missed a payment" text message or email.
